Hang Seng Bank, Hong Kong’s Fourth Largest, Is a Listed Subsidiary of HSBC – Morningstar
Hang Seng Bank has a 7% share of deposits in Hong Kong as of the end of 2023, ranking fourth in the market after HSBC with 33%, Bank of China (Hong Kong) with 16%, and Standard Chartered with 12%.
